4 Days of Fun in Mannheim: Budget Travel Guide

Discover Mannheim's charm without breaking the bank.

21 June 2023

Mannheim is a charming city in Germany that offers affordable travel options for budget-conscious travelers. Visitors can explore the diverse attractions such as the Luisenpark, the Mannheim Palace, and the Reiss-Engelhorn Museum. For a cost-effective trip, opt to stay in a hostel or a budget-friendly hotel and try local street food or local supermarkets for meals.

Day 2

Heidelberg trip

  • Take a 35-minute train ride to Heidelberg, a beautiful historic town.
  • Visit the Heidelberg Castle, a stunning ruin with panoramic views of the town and Neckar river.
  • Walk through the Old Heidelberg Town, with charming cobble-stoned streets and quaint shops.
  • Lunch at Schnitzelbank, a cozy German restaurant with a wide selection of schnitzel.
  • Cross the old bridge to visit the Philosopher's Walk, a scenic trail with breathtaking views.
  • Dinner at Vetter's Alt Heidelberger Brauhaus, a traditional German brewery with delicious beer and food.

How to get there

Plane

The best way to get to Mannheim, Germany by plane would be to fly into Frankfurt Airport and take a direct ICE train from Frankfurt Airport Station to Mannheim Hauptbahnhof. The journey takes approximately 30 minutes.

Car

If traveling by car to Mannheim, Germany, take the A6 motorway from Frankfurt to Mannheim, which takes approximately 1 hour.

Train

One of the best ways to get to Mannheim, Germany by train is to take an ICE train from Berlin Hauptbahnhof to Mannheim Hauptbahnhof. The journey takes approximately 4 hours and 30 minutes.

Boat

While there are no direct boat services to Mannheim, one can take a river cruise from Frankfurt to Mannheim or from Strasbourg, France to Mannheim, which takes approximately 2 hours and 30 minutes.

Bus

The best way to get to Mannheim, Germany by bus would be to take a Flixbus from Munich ZOB to Mannheim ZOB. The journey takes approximately 4 hours and 30 minutes.
